Irving Oil, Shaw's Supermarkets offering gas promo

PORTSMOUTH, N.H. -- Irving Oil Corp. recently launched a gasoline discount promotion with Shaw's Supermarkets. More than 40,000 Irving customers have saved money on fuel since the promotion began three weeks ago, the company said, and customers have been saving an average of 24 cents per gallon when redeeming their Shaw's coupons at participating Irving locations.

"This is a great way for people to save when they are purchasing two essential items—fuel and food," said Ross Elkin of Irving's Gas Rewards Team. "We want to remind everyone that the program lasts until February 14, and [image-nocss] any coupons collected up until that time can be redeemed until February 28."

There are 57 Shaw's Supermarkets and more than 140 Irving locations participating in the program throughout Maine and New Hampshire.

Customers shop at participating Shaw's stores with their Shaw's Rewards Card. Gasoline coupons valued at 10 cents per gallon, redeemable at participating Irving locations for up to 20 gallons of fuel, will be issued after a minimum purchase is made. Savings grow up to 60 cents per gallon on a $300 purchase.

Customers present their Shaw's Rewards Card and gasoline coupons at Irving to receive the discounts. Customers can combine the discount coupons up to the price per gallon of gasoline, and some who have collected enough coupons in the pilot program have received a full tank of fuel for free, the company said.

Shaw's, Osco and Star Market are a division of SUPERVALU Inc. Throughout the six New England states, there are more than 200 store locations.

Portsmouth, N.H.-based Irving Oil is a regional refining and marketing company serving customers in New England and Eastern Canada with a range of finished energy products, including gasoline, diesel, home heating fuel, lubricants, jet fuel and complementary products and services. The company operates a network of Bluecanoe and Mainway convenience stores throughout New England and Eastern Canada.
